1 yum 安装
安装依赖
yum install libevent libevent-devel
安装 memcached
yum install memcached
2 源码安装
wget http://memcached.org/latest 下载最新版本
tar -zxvf memcached-1.x.x.tar.gz 解压源码
cd memcached-1.x.x 进入目录
./configure --prefix=/usr/local/memcached 配置
make && make test 编译
make install 安装
3 常用命令说明
-d 是启动一个守护进程;
-m 是分配给Memcache使用的内存数量,单位是MB;
-u 是运行Memcache的用户;
-l 是监听的服务器IP地址,可以有多个地址;
-p 是设置Memcache监听的端口,,最好是1024以上的端口;
-c 是最大运行的并发连接数,默认是1024;
-P 是设置保存Memcache的pid文件。
-vv verbose打印命令和响应信息
-v 打印error 和warning 信息
4 服务启动
前台程序运行
memcached -p 11211 -m 64m -vv
后台程序运行
memcached -p 11211 -m 64m -d
或
memcached -d -m 64M -u root -l 127.0.0.1 -p 11211 -c 256 -P /tmp/memcached.pid
5 memcached 连接
使用telnet 连接